$80 Million Boost for Housing and Homelessness in New Mexico

Story summary
  • Albuquerque and Bernalillo County will receive $80 million for housing and homelessness projects from a $120 million statewide initiative in New Mexico.
  • Governor Michelle Lujan Grisham stresses the urgent need to tackle housing and homelessness issues.
  • The funding will support affordable housing developments and services for vulnerable populations.
  • California's Proposition 1 allocates $6.4 billion for behavioral health and housing, with $178.4 million awarded for 518 affordable homes.
  • Governor Gavin Newsom notes California's effective strategy in reducing homelessness relative to national trends.
